Incentives To Work
Factors or motivations that encourage individuals to perform tasks or engage in employment.
Income-Maintenance Program
Governmental policies designed to provide financial support to individuals or families to ensure a basic level of income and prevent poverty.
Social Insurance
Government-provided insurance, typically funded through taxation, that covers individuals against economic risks (e.g., unemployment, disability).
Poverty Rate
The percentage of a population living below the national poverty line, reflecting the proportion of society facing economic hardship.
